Anand Bhankhari Population - Mahesana, Gujarat

Anand Bhankhari is a medium size village located in Satlasana Taluka of Mahesana district, Gujarat with total 136 families residing. The Anand Bhankhari village has population of 771 of which 397 are males while 374 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Anand Bhankhari village population of children with age 0-6 is 92 which makes up 11.93 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Anand Bhankhari village is 942 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Anand Bhankhari as per census is 1091,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Anand Bhankhari village has higher liter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Anand Bhankhari village was 80.85 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Anand Bhankhari Male literacy stands at 91.78 % while female literacy rate was 69.02 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Anand Bhankhari village of Mahesana district.

Work Profile

In Anand Bhankhari village out of total population, 486 were engaged in work activities. 49.79 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 50.21 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 486 workers engaged in Main Work, 115 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 89 were Agricultural labourer.
